Memorial Heights Nursing Center

Idabel, Mccurtain County, Oklahoma · CCN 375123 · Non-profit (Corporation) · not part of a chain

CMS rates Memorial Heights Nursing Center 2 of 5 overall as of August 2026. 118 certified beds, 89 residents a day on average. 28 citations on record from the current inspection cycles, 1 involving actual harm; 1 fine totalling $7,443.
